The New York Islanders shocked the NHL, dismissing Patrick Roy and hiring a highly surprising choice for the foreseeable future.
With four games left in the regular season, the Islanders have fired head coach Patrick Roy and hired Peter DeBoer, general manager Mathieu Darche announced on Sunday.
